Quote:
ScarabChris - 2/19/2009 9:40 PM

So I guess they are calling the 25 footer a 26 now? Whats with the tiny T-tops?
The 26 is a completly different boat than the 25. The smaller hard tops are for aerodynamics. A larger soft top is offered as well.

the smaller top is so you can still support radar, antennas, E-box, rod-holders and all that other good stuff without it being in the way of rods when fishin, and so you dodnt need to put a bunch of holes through it for rod tips if you want console mounted rod holders. I would prefer the Key-West style over this but to each is own.
